Add 14/56 and 20/7
1st number: 14/56, 2nd number: 2 6/7
14/56 + 20/7 is 87/28.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 56 and 7 is 56
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 56 - For the 1st fraction, since 56 × 1 = 56,
14/56 = 14 × 1/56 × 1 = 14/56 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 7 × 8 = 56,
20/7 = 20 × 8/7 × 8 = 160/56 - Add the two like fractions:
14/56 + 160/56 = 14 + 160/56 = 174/56 - 174/56 simplified gives 87/28
- So, 14/56 + 20/7 = 87/28
